ENERGY STAR Certified Uninterruptible Power Supplies

Certified models meet all ENERGY STAR requirements as listed in the Version 2.0 ENERGY STAR Program Requirements for Uninterruptible Power Supplies that are effective as of January 1, 2019. A detailed listing of key efficiency criteria are available at https://www.energystar.gov/products/office_equipment/uninterruptible_power_supplies/key_product_criteria
